The Dundorfische Bürgerforum is a political party in the Dundorfisches Reich with primarily liberal viewpoints. The Dundorfische Bürgerforum supports the cause of the Monarchy, with many of it's members being of the minor nobility and the middle-class citizenry. The party was founded in 3040 by Gottfried Thiem, a former MP in the Herrenhaus without party representation, he sitting as the party's first chairman.
